HUM-1200: US History

Provides an overview of key moments and issues in US History with a focus on what it means to be a citizen/resident/inhabitant of the US today and how that has changed throughout US history. Examines how the many populations of the North American continent have come to relate to one another and have struggled to find a way to live together, and how these efforts have been informed by ideals of democracy and human sights.
